Check Engine - P02A2

The check engine light in my 2015 F56 is lit - not flashing. The fault code is P02A2 (Cylinder 3 Balance – Fuel Trim at Max Limit).

Should I just erase the code and see if the fault goes away?
Should I limit my driving until I can schedule service?

I picked up the car from Mini service. They pulled a couple of codes of their own:

114301 - Fuel-Air mixture too lean cylinder 3
20A504 - Turbocharger coolant pump actuation - Line disconnection

After testing/inspecting a variety of things, they found that a connection was not making full contact with the coolant pump. They corrected the connection and cleared the faults - that cleared the check engine light and their test drive was normal.

Everything seems fine now.
